Interscope's Rock Podcast

Interscope iRock PodcastThe major record rabel Interscope recently released The Rock Podcast program through Apple's iTunes. The first episode contains tracks from a number bands published by the label (like NIN, U2, and AudioSlave)with interviews and other good stuff coming in the future.

This level of endorsement from a major record label like Interscope shows that the industry has quickly embraced this medium as a way to promote their artists.

While I think it's great, it would be even better if they included the entire song in the Podcast, truly embracing it as a replacement for radio - but only adding snippets, it's just not the experience that Podcasting should be.
